High Bay Storage

High Bay storage is designed to unlock vertical cube—often exceeding 60 feet—to nearly double capacity versus conventional rack heights. Advance High Bay systems can exceed 60’H, and can be paired with fully automated or man-up vehicles depending on throughput and labor strategy.

Structural High Bay Application:
Structural high bay is the go-to choice for tall storage where stability, impact tolerance, and long-term reliability matter. Structural rack’s heavier construction and durability support demanding operations and reduce lifecycle disruptions.

Roll Form High Bay Application:
Roll-formed high bay can be appropriate for lighter-duty needs where budgets and modular growth are key, but requires strong protection and controlled equipment interaction because roll form members can be more susceptible to damage.

Industry relevance:
High bay is a natural fit for cold storage (cube is expensive), beverage (dense reserve), and high-growth food distribution networks trying to scale within existing footprints.
